GotoBus > Miami, FL > 316 NE 167th St
Beijing Mart
316 NE 167th St
Miami, FL 33162
United States of America
Beijing Mart
316 NE 167th St
Miami, FL 33162
United States of America
Get directions: To here - From hereShow Parking